Occidental Taksim, Istanbul
About the Hotel
Occidental Taksim Hotel is a 4-star accommodation located in the Beyoglu district of Istanbul. The hotel boasts 162 modern rooms and versatile event spaces, a wellness center, and diverse dining options. Situated just steps from Taksim Square, it provides easy access to significant local attractions.
Location
Located in a prime area, Occidental Taksim is within walking distance of significant sites such as Dolmabahce Palace and Galata Tower. Taksim Station is a five-minute walk, providing access to public transport options that connect the hotel with other parts of Istanbul. The hotel is approximately 45 kilometers from Istanbul International Airport.
Rooms
The hotel offers 162 well-appointed rooms, including family suites and deluxe options measuring 40-150 square meters. Each room features a modern design, free high-speed Wi-Fi, an LED TV, and a minibar, ensuring comfort for couples and families alike. Family suites include two connecting rooms and separate living areas, providing ample space for relaxation.
Eat & Drink
Occidental Taksim features two restaurants and a café, with an emphasis on fresh, local ingredients for its O!Breakfast buffet. The bistro serves Mediterranean cuisine, while the atmosphere is designed to be urban yet relaxed. Both dining venues offer a diverse menu catering to various palates and dietary preferences.
Leisure & Business
The hotel provides a full range of leisure facilities, including a wellness and spa center, sauna, and indoor pool available daily from 10:00 am to 11:00 pm. For business travelers, the property boasts six versatile meeting rooms equipped with high-speed internet, accommodating up to 460 guests. An on-site fitness center is available for those looking to maintain their workout routines.
